At the forefront of technological advancement lies the concept of empowering intelligent devices at the edge. This paradigm shift involves deploying processing power and cognitive algorithms directly to edge devices, reducing the reliance on centralized cloud computing. By bringing intelligence closer to the point of interaction, we can achieve immediate responses, improve data security, and unlock new possibilities for applications.

Decentralizing Intelligence: The Rise of Edge AI Solutions

The landscape of artificial intelligence shifting dramatically, with a growing shift towards edge computing. This paradigm empowers the deployment of advanced algorithms directly on devices at the boundary of the network, rather than relying on centralized cloud infrastructure. This evolution offers a range of benefits, such as reduced latency, improved data security, and enhanced reliability in applications where real-time analysis is crucial.

Edge AI solutions are quickly emerging across diverse industries, from robotics to connected devices and industrial automation. By pushing intelligence closer to the source, these solutions enable a new generation of interactive systems that can evolve in real-time, responding intelligently to dynamic situations.

Connecting the Gap: Edge Intelligence for Real-Time Decision Making

In today's rapidly evolving landscape, where data deluge and prompt decision making are paramount, edge intelligence emerges as a transformative technology. By processing data at the source, edge intelligence empowers applications to react swiftly to changing conditions, minimizing latency and unlocking new possibilities for innovation.

This paradigm shift facilitates a wide range of applications, from autonomous vehicles that navigate complex environments in real time to smart factories that optimize production processes with unprecedented accuracy.

Edge intelligence furthermore holds immense potential for improving customer experiences by providing personalized recommendations and streamlining interactions.

A Distributed Horizon: Transforming Industries with Edge AI

The landscape of industry is on the brink of a profound transformation, driven by the rise of distributed artificial intelligence (AI) at the edge. Traditionally, AI applications have relied on centralized data centers, posing challenges in terms of latency and connectivity. Edge AI revolutionizes this paradigm by bringing AI algorithms directly to the perimeter of data generation.
